Meaning of rollers

noun
  1. (heading) Anything that rolls.
  2. A long wide bandage used in surgery.
  3. A large, wide, curling wave that falls back on itself as it breaks on a coast.
  4. (heading) A bird.
  5. A police patrol car or patrolman (rather than an unmarked police car or a detective)
  6. A padded surcingle that is used on horses for training and vaulting.
  7. A roll of titles or (especially) credits played over film or video; television or film credits.
  8. A wheelchair user.

verb

To roller skate.
